Oil Pan: Removal
- Disconnect negative battery cable. Place vehicle on hoist. Remove front wheels. Remove intake air duct, and air cleaner upper cover. Disconnect front oxygen sensor harness connector located below intake air duct. Remove torque strut (pitching stopper). Remove upper radiator brackets. Install engine lifting device and raise engine enough to take weight off engine mounts.
- Raise and support vehicle. Remove under cover(s). Drain engine oil. Disconnect rear oxygen sensor harness connector. Separate front catalytic converter from center exhaust pipe. Remove front and center exhaust pipe assembly from engine. Remove front and center exhaust pipe assembly from hanger bracket. Remove bolt that secures front and center exhaust pipe assembly on bracket.
- Remove front engine mount-to-crossmember nuts. Remove oil pan bolts. Using gasket cutter blade inserted between oil pan and engine block, cut through sealant and remove oil pan. DO NOT use screwdriver or pry bar to remove oil pan. Remove oil pick-up brace clamp strap and remove oil pick-up. Remove oil pick-up baffle. Remove all sealant from oil pan and engine block.
